문서 메뉴
문서 홈
/
MongoDB 매뉴얼
/ / /

acosh(집계)

이 페이지의 내용

  • 행동
  • 예제
$acosh

값의 역쌍곡선 코사인(쌍곡선 아크 코사인)을 반환합니다.

$acosh 의 구문은 다음과 같습니다:

{ $acosh: <expression> }

$acosh1 에서 +Infinity 사이의 숫자로 해석되는 모든 유효한 표현식 을 사용합니다(예: 1 <= value <= +Infinity.

$acosh는 값을 라디안 단위로 반환합니다. 출력 값을 라디안에서 각도로 변환하려면 $radiansToDegrees 연산자를 사용하세요.

기본적으로 $acosh 값은 double로 반환합니다. $acosh<expression>이 128-비트 십진수 값으로 확인되는 한 값을 128-비트 십진수로 반환할 수도 있습니다.

표현식에 대한 자세한 내용은 표현식 연산자를 참조하세요.

인수가 null 값으로 해석되거나 누락된 필드를 참조하는 경우 $acoshnull을 반환합니다. 인수가 NaN으로 확인되는 경우, $acoshNaN을 반환합니다. 인수가 음의 무한대로 해석되면 $acosh에서 오류가 발생합니다. 인수가 Infinity로 해석되면 $acoshInfinity을 반환합니다. 인수가 [-1, Infinity] 의 경계를 벗어난 값으로 해석되면 $acosh에서 오류가 발생합니다.

예제
결과
{ $acosh: NaN }
NaN
{ $acosh: null }
null
{ $acosh : Infinity}
Infinity
{ $acosh : 0 }

다음과 같은 형식의 출력과 유사한 오류 메시지를 표시합니다.

"errmsg" :
"Failed to optimize pipeline :: caused by :: cannot
apply $acosh to -inf, value must in (1,inf)"
← acos(집계)

이 페이지의 내용